# OTA Channel — Quickstart

Welcome to the Briarhale firmware team. Devices on the Cindermark H2 line poll the `edge-ota` channel every six hours. You push builds via `otactl publish`; staging first, always. Promotion to production requires two approvals in the Relay dashboard. Rollbacks are automatic if the watchdog trips three boots in a row. Never publish unsigned images — the bootloader rejects them hard. Configure your local signing setup with the deploy key provided below.

release key, hadug-kawef: bky13_mPGeFZeR1GZ1G

### Runbook: SDK Parity Checks

Quick context for the sync: the Tidelark web and mobile SDKs are supposed to stay feature-identical, and the parity bot diffs their public APIs nightly. If it flags a gap, ping whoever owns the lagging SDK before release cut. The bot itself rarely breaks, but when it does, check the settings below first.

deployment values, kajep-kageg:
[praix]
host = praix.paliqcorp.corp
user = praix_svc
database = praix_prod

**Q: FeedCheckr is flagging valid podcast feeds as broken. What do I do?**

First, don't panic — it's usually the enclosure-size probe timing out, not the feed itself. Bump the probe timeout in the Varnwell config and re-run validation. If feeds still fail after two retries, it's probably the parser cache. When in doubt, ping the maintainers at the address below.

alerts address for yajof-kahog: eliax@qirvanlabs.corp

## Break-Glass Access: LiftPath Simulator

Welcome aboard. The LiftPath elevator-dispatch simulator runs on an isolated cluster, and contractor accounts normally cannot restart stuck simulation shards. If a shard deadlocks and the Orbane team is unreachable, you are authorized to use the break-glass console. Every use is logged and reviewed within one business day, so document your reasoning in the run journal first. When prompted, the console will ask for the recovery passphrase, which is recorded directly below this paragraph.

unlock words, fafop-hawep: briwyn-oliix-sorox